SMART datagrid v1.4 > Classes > DLBase

Back  Forward

DataLudi.DLBase.setProperties  method

매개변수 props에 json 객체나 배열로 지정한 속성 값들로 기존 값들을 변경한다. 

속성 설정 순서가 중요한 경우 배열로 지정할 수 있는데, [속성 이름, 값, 이름, 값, ...] 형태로 들어 있어야 한다. 

이 메소드는 this를 리턴한다. 또, 아래 처럼 각 속성 이름에 "."로 구분되는 속성 경로를 지정할 수 있다. 

function setProperties (props: Object, raiseError: Boolean): this;
Returns
this
Parameters
props - Object. required.
raiseError - Boolean. 기본값은 false.
Code -1
    grid.setProperties({
        'header.height': 50,
        'footer.height': 30
        'checkBar.visible': false
    });

    // 순서가 중요하면 배열로 전달
    grid.setProperties([
        'header.height', 50,
        'footer.height', 30
        'checkBar.visible', false
    ]);
See Also
setProperty
getProperty
getProperties
assign
DataLudi Class System
Examples
Hello Grid
Hello Tree